概要

概要

クラウドERPの世界市場は、2023年に486億3,000万米ドルに達し、2031年には1,762億8,000万米ドルに達すると予測され、予測期間2024年~2031年のCAGRは17.41%で成長する見込みです。

クラウドベースの企業資源計画(ERP)ソリューション開拓における人工知能(AI)および機械学習(ML)技術の迅速な統合とともに、遅延や混乱などの潜在的な問題を検出する高度な分析機能を備えた洗練されたERPソリューションに対する需要の増加が、市場拡大を促進する重要な動向として認識されています。

この分野では、中小企業の需要が増加しています。中小企業はこうしたERPシステムを活用することで、部門間のコミュニケーションやコラボレーションを促進し、透明性を確立することで業務を改善します。消費者データと財務データの両方を単一のシステムに統合することもできます。2023年3月、SAP SEは中堅企業向けのクラウドベースのERPソリューションを発表し、効果的なビジネス管理を促進し、不安定なマーケットプレースの問題に対処します。

北米市場の成長は、オンプレミスとクラウドのインフラを統合するハイブリッドクラウドソリューションの採用が同地域の企業で増加していることに起因します。クラウドERPソリューションは、ハイブリッド構成とのシームレスな統合を促進し、企業はオンプレミスシステムの管理とクラウドが提供するスケーラビリティを統合することができます。クラウドERPとアナリティクスを統合することで、企業はデータから有用な知見を導き出し、情報に基づいた意思決定を行うことができるようになり、市場の拡大を促進します。

ダイナミクス

ジェネレーティブAIの台頭

ジェネレーティブAI(GenAI)は、効率を大幅に改善し、業務を最適化することで、職場のダイナミクスとインタラクションに革命をもたらしています。GenAIをクラウドERPシステムと統合することで、企業は業務効率を高め、意思決定プロセスを変革し、予測アルゴリズムを実装し、自動化とデータ分析を促進することができます。この革新的なテクノロジーは、プロセスの効率性を特定し、リアルタイムの情報を提供することで、組織の俊敏性を高めます。

さらに、クラウドERPソリューションにAIを活用することで、企業は本質的なオペレーションを強化し、継続的な学習と優れたパフォーマンスへの適応を促進することができます。2023年10月、デロイトはERPクライアントにGenAIソリューションを提供するため、SAP Business Technology Platform(SAP BTP)を強化しました。同社のイノベーションであるClean Core+Edgeは、クラウドアプリケーション開発とAI機能の統合に依存し、クラウドERPクライアントが真のビジネスインサイトを提供できるよう支援します。

さらに、2024年2月、KyndrylはGenAIとResponsible AIの進歩を促進するためにGoogle Cloudとの連携を強化しました。この協業により、KyndrylはGoogle Cloud Cortex Frameworkを活用し、Google Cloud上のERPデータの価値を高めることができるようになった。

クラウドERPとアナリティクスの融合

クラウドERPは、組織の多面的な洞察を瞬時に提供し、迅速でより多くの情報に基づいた意思決定を促進します。これは、急速に進化するビジネスの競争力を維持するために非常に重要です。高度な分析機能を備えた洗練されたERPソリューションを使用する必要性が高まっていることは、あらゆる業界において明らかです。さらに、AIや機械学習技術をこれらの製品に組み込むことで、より高度で洗練された洞察を提供できるようになっています。

オーダーメイドのダッシュボードやレポートを作成し、主要業績評価指標(KPI)の包括的な概要を提供します。2023年9月、オラクル株式会社はOracle Fusion ERP Analyticsの一部としてAccounting Hub Analyticsを発表し、金融会社が会計データに対する洞察を提供できるようにしました。Oracle ERPデータとAccounting Hubのサブ帳票アプリケーション・データの融合により、包括的な分析のための強固な基盤が確立されます。

Saas(Software As A Service)型ERPソリューションではカスタマイズの選択肢が制限される

クラウドベースのERPシステムは、拡張性、費用対効果、アクセシビリティなど、さまざまなメリットを提供しますが、個々の企業固有の要件に対応するためのプログラムのカスタマイズに制約が生じることがよくあります。SaaS型ERPソリューションは、広範な業種や企業を対象に、広範囲に標準化され、適応できるように設計されています。そのため、特定の企業のニーズを満たすには、柔軟性や適応性が不十分な場合があります。

多様なセクターの企業は、ライバルと差別化するための独特で複雑な手順を頻繁に持っています。SaaSのERPソリューションは、その標準化されたアプローチのために、企業が非効率につながる可能性があり、ソフトウェアに合わせて既存のプロセスを変更する必要があり、ユニークなワークフローを受け入れない場合があります。SaaS型ERPシステムは、一定レベルのカスタマイズを提供するが、一般的にオンプレミス型ERPソリューションよりも制約が多いです。ユーザーは、自社のニーズを的確に満たすためにプログラムを広範囲に変更することは困難であると感じるかもしれないです。

Overview

Global Cloud ERP Market reached US$ 48.63 billion in 2023 and is expected to reach US$ 176.28 billion by 2031, growing with a CAGR of 17.41% during the forecast period 2024-2031.

The increasing demand for sophisticated ERP solutions equipped with advanced analytics capabilities to detect potential issues like delays and disruptions, along with the swift integration of artificial intelligence (AI) and machine learning (ML) technologies in the development of cloud-based enterprise resource planning (ERP) solutions, are recognized as significant trends driving market expansion.

The sector is experiencing increased demand for small and mid-sized enterprises. Small and medium-sized enterprises utilize such ERP systems to foster communication and collaboration among departments and improve business operations by establishing transparency. It may consolidate both their consumer and financial data into a single system. In March 2023, SAP SE introduced a cloud-based ERP solution for midsize enterprises to facilitate effective business management and address issues in volatile marketplaces.

The market growth in North America is attributable to the increasing adoption of hybrid cloud solutions that integrate on-premises and cloud infrastructures by organizations in the region. Cloud ERP solutions facilitate seamless integration with hybrid configurations, allowing enterprises to merge the management of on-premises systems with the scalability offered by the cloud. Integrating cloud ERP with analytics enables businesses to derive useful insights from their data, facilitating informed decision-making, which will propel market expansion.

Dynamics

Rising Generative AI

Generative AI (GenAI) is revolutionizing workplace dynamics and interactions by markedly improving efficiency and optimizing business operations. By integrating GenAI with cloud ERP systems, firms may enhance operational efficiency, transform decision-making processes, implement predictive algorithms and facilitate automation and data analysis. The innovative technology enhances organizational agility by identifying process efficiencies and providing real-time information.

Moreover, utilizing AI in cloud ERP solutions enables firms to enhance essential operations, facilitating ongoing learning and adaption for superior performance. In October 2023, Deloitte enhanced the SAP Business Technology Platform (SAP BTP) to deliver GenAI solutions to ERP clients. The company's innovation, Clean Core + Edge, relies on cloud application development and the integration of AI capabilities to assist cloud ERP clients in providing genuine business insights.

Furthermore, in February 2024, Kyndryl enhanced its collaboration with Google Cloud to expedite the advancement of GenAI and Responsible AI. The collaboration allowed Kyndryl to utilize the Google Cloud Cortex Framework to enhance the value of ERP data on Google Cloud.

Fusion of Analytics With Cloud ERP

Cloud ERP offers instantaneous insights into multiple facets of the organization, facilitating expedited and more informed decision-making. This is crucial for maintaining competitiveness in rapidly evolving businesses. The increasing necessity to use sophisticated ERP solutions with advanced analytics capabilities is evident across all industries since they can detect delays and disruptions. Furthermore, AI and machine learning technologies are being incorporated into these products to provide enhanced and sophisticated insights.

It produce tailored dashboards and reports, offering a comprehensive overview of Key Performance Indicators (KPIs). In September 2023, Oracle Corporation launched Accounting Hub Analytics as part of Oracle Fusion ERP Analytics to enable financial firms to provide insights into accounting data. The amalgamation of Oracle ERP data with the Accounting Hub sub-ledger application data establishes a robust foundation for comprehensive analysis.

Restricted Customization Choices For Software As A Service (Saas) ERP Solutions

Cloud-based ERP systems provide various benefits, including scalability, cost-effectiveness and accessibility; however, they frequently impose limitations on customizing the program to address the unique requirements of individual enterprises. SaaS ERP solutions are engineered to be extensively standardized and adaptable, targeting a wide array of sectors and enterprises. Consequently, they may exhibit insufficient flexibility and adaptability to meet the needs of certain companies.

Enterprises throughout diverse sectors frequently possess distinctive and intricate procedures that differentiate them from their rivals. SaaS ERP solutions, due to their standardized approach, may not accept unique workflows, necessitating enterprises to modify existing processes to align with the software, which could lead to inefficiencies. SaaS ERP systems provide a certain level of customisation, although it is generally more constrained than that of on-premises ERP solutions. Users may find it challenging to extensively change the program to precisely meet their own company needs.

ERP Innovations and Strategic Partnerships Driving IT & Telecomm Growth

The advent of 5G technology has generated novel prospects for the IT and telecommunications sectors. Cloud ERP providers have begun to emphasize the integration of functionalities for managing and optimizing 5G network resources, hence assuring effective service delivery and enhancing customer experience, which is anticipated to propel market expansion.

In September 2022, Mavenir, a network software supplier, announced the integration of Google Cloud's public cloud infrastructure with cloud-native 5G solutions. Mavenir and Google Cloud's collaboration will empower Communications Service Providers (CSPs) to utilize Google Cloud's scalable infrastructure, advanced data analytics capabilities, container deployment and management tools, as well as 5G applications and solutions. It reduces complexity and costs for CSPs by transitioning segments of conventional telecom application operations to the cloud, without compromising network management, performance or insights.

Geographical Penetration

Cloud ERP Growth And Adoption in Asia-Pacific's Expanding E-Commerce Landscape

Asia-Pacific has experienced rapid growth in digital adoption and e-commerce, with nations like China, India, South Korea and Japan making notable progress in cloud ERP implementation. The technologies encompass cloud-native architecture, metadata-driven multi-tenant architecture and real-time intelligence. Such innovations are anticipated to enhance market expansion in the region.

For instance, in April 2023, Huawei, a manufacturing firm, announced the replacement of its previous ERP system with its fully controlled MetaERP system. 80% of Huawei's business operations and all business contexts are managed with MetaERP. Moreover, Huawei has partnered with collaborators to include innovative technologies into the MetaERP system, significantly enhancing service efficiency and operational quality.

Chinese enterprises are seeking to modernize their operations and compete on a global scale, frequently opting for Cloud ERP solutions as a cost-efficient and scalable approach to accomplish this objective. Furthermore, when enterprises grow, they necessitate ERP systems that oversee intricate operations across several areas and adhere to differing regulatory standards. The proliferation of enterprises into burgeoning domestic marketplaces enhances the utilization of Cloud ERP solutions.

Russia-Ukraine War Impact Analysis

The Russia-Ukraine crisis has significantly influenced the Cloud ERP market, particularly regarding cybersecurity and data protection. Organizations are currently emphasizing cyber resilience due to the rising frequency of advanced cyberattacks from state-sponsored hacker collectives like REvil and Emissary Panda. The threats have highlighted the necessity for enterprises to implement a risk-based strategy to detect vulnerabilities in their defense mechanisms and to conduct cyber threat intelligence (CTI) evaluations.

As a result, enterprises are allocating increased resources towards comprehensive cybersecurity measures for their Cloud ERP systems, particularly in hybrid and multi-cloud settings where threat surveillance is essential. Artificial intelligence (AI) is significantly enhancing Cloud ERP security. AI and machine learning (ML) tools are becoming indispensable for identifying and alleviating risks on cloud platforms like Azure, AWS and M365.

Companies such as Vectra are offering complimentary AI-driven detection solutions to enterprises affected by the conflict, facilitating swift threat identification and action to avert significant harm from possible cyber catastrophes. By sifting through the complexities of IT settings, AI facilitates the rapid detection of anomalous activities, which is essential given the heightened danger of cyberattacks on Cloud ERP infrastructures due to escalating geopolitical tensions.
